SC denies bail in Circular Trading / Fraudulent GST ITC Claim case

May 27, 2019 8991 Views 0 comment Print

Supreme Court has upheld Telangana High Court judgment in the case of P.V. Ramana Reddy Vs Union of India & Ors. that held that a person can be arrested by the competent authority in cases of Goods and Service Tax (GST) evasion.
